The 48V 1x Mustang Battery Kit typically includes a 48V lithium-ion battery pack, a compatible charger, and essential mounting hardware. These kits are designed for electric vehicle conversions, such as upgrading bicycles or light EVs, providing high energy density and power output. Advanced versions may integrate a DC/DC converter to support 12V accessories. Pro Tip: Verify compatibility with your motor controller—mismatched voltage tolerances can cause system failures.

What core components define a 48V battery kit?
A standard 48V kit centers on a lithium-ion battery pack (10-20Ah capacity) and a smart charger with temperature monitoring. The battery often uses LiFePO4 cells for thermal stability, while the charger employs CC-CV protocols. For example, a Mustang kit might include a 48V 15Ah battery delivering 720Wh—enough for 40–50 km in e-bikes. Pro Tip: Always store batteries at 50% charge in non-use periods to prevent capacity degradation.

How does the DC/DC converter enhance functionality?
The DC/DC converter steps down 48V to 12V, powering lights, displays, and controllers. High-efficiency models (≥90% conversion rate) minimize energy loss. In practice, a 10A converter can support 120W of 12V loads without draining the main battery. Pro Tip: Opt for converters with overload protection—unregulated current draws can fry low-voltage circuits.

Are mounting systems universal across kits?
Mounting hardware varies by application—e-bike kits use frame-specific brackets, while EV conversions require bolt-on trays. Mustang kits often include adjustable steel brackets with anti-vibration pads. For instance, a 48V battery mounted on a bike’s downtube needs 3–5mm rubber insulation to prevent short circuits from frame contact. Pro Tip: Measure your vehicle’s clearance—oversized batteries may interfere with steering or suspension.

What safety features are prioritized?
Quality kits integrate BMS protection against overcharge, deep discharge, and short circuits. Multi-layer safeguards include temperature sensors and cell balancing. Imagine a BMS cutting power at 54.6V (full charge) or 40V (empty)—this extends cycle life by 300+ charges. Pro Tip: Regularly check BMS firmware updates—manufacturers often patch thermal management algorithms.

How does charger compatibility impact performance?
Chargers must match the battery’s voltage profile and chemistry. A LiFePO4-specific charger terminates at 54.6V, whereas NMC needs 50.4V. Using a mismatched charger risks undercharging (reduced range) or overcharging (fire hazards). For example, a Mustang kit charger with 5A output refills a 15Ah battery in 3 hours. Pro Tip: Carry a portable charger with DC input for roadside emergencies—solar-compatible models add versatility.

Does the kit include a warranty?
Most manufacturers offer 1–3 years on batteries and 6–12 months on chargers. Confirm cycle limits—some warranties void after 500 full discharges.
